IDUKKI: Hameed, accused in the Cheenikuzhy massacre, said the murder was committed after his son failed to look after him despite being given the property. He killed his son Faizal, his wife Sheeba and their children Mehra and Azna.
He said that he had shared his property between his two children. The family house and the land adjacent to it was given to Faizal. The condition was that he should take care of him and can take the income from the land. However, his son did not follow that.
A fight broke out between Hameed and his son yesterday morning. A verbal dispute and some unruly scenes were witnessed. Hameed, who went out returned with five bottles of petrol. He poured two bottles of petrol into the house and set it on fire.
He locked the house from outside to prevent his son and his family from escaping. He also drained out water from the water tank. The incident happened late last night. The accused is in police custody now.
